▲
WARNING
Failure to follow these instructions or
to properly install and maintain this
equipment could result in an explosion,
fire and/or chemical contamination
causing property damage and personal
injury or death.
Enardo spring-loaded pressure/vacuum
relief valve must be installed, operated
and maintained in accordance with
federal, state and local codes, rules
and regulations, and Emerson Process
Management Regulator Technologies
Tulsa, LLC (Emerson) instructions.
Failure to correct trouble could result in
a hazardous condition. Call a qualified
service person to service the unit.
Installation, operation and maintenance
procedures performed by unqualified
person may result in improper
adjustment and unsafe operation. Either
condition may result in equipment
damage or personal injury. Only a
qualified person shall install or service
the spring-loaded pressure/vacuum
relief valve.
Introduction
Scope of the Manual
This Instruction Manual provides instructions
for installation, maintenance and parts ordering
information for the 860 and 960 Series spring-loaded
pressure/vacuum relief valve (SL-PVRV).
